MUMBAI, India, July 24 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202641085153 A) filed by Jntuh University College Of Engineering on July 11, 2026, for Walmart Sales Forecasting Using Machine Learning And Time-Series Models.

Inventors include Dr. K. Santhi Sree; Ujjelli Lokesh Reddy; Kathi Mounika; Pedapalli Sobhitha; Mellacheruvu Venkata Gaayatri; C Shiva Rama Krishna; M. Srimani; Gurri Suvidha Reddy; Erri Suvarna; Hanumandla Naga Shiva; Chirra Karthik; V. Nithin; and Kayam Sravani.

The application for the patent was published on July 17, 2026, under issue no. 29/2026.

Abstract: The present invention discloses a hybrid retail sales forecasting system integrating machine learning and time-series modelling for accurate weekly sales prediction. The system comprises a Data Preprocessing Module for preparing historical sales data, a Feature Engineering Module for generating temporal predictive features, a Prophet Forecasting Module for modelling trend, seasonality, holiday effects, and changepoints, a Residual Computation Module for calculating forecasting errors, an XGBoost Residual Prediction Module for learning nonlinear residual patterns, a Hybrid Forecast Generation Module for combining Prophet forecasts with predicted residual values, an Evaluation Module for assessing forecasting performance using Mean Absolute Error (MAE), Root Mean Squared Error (RMSE), and Mean Absolute Percentage Error (MAPE), and a Forecast Visualization Module for presenting forecast results. The integrated framework combines statistical time-series decomposition with machine learning-based residual correction to improve forecasting accuracy, reduce prediction error, and generate scalable, interpretable, and reliable weekly sales forecasts suitable for inventory planning, supply chain management, and retail business decision support.
